Collabro release Hurricane Irma charity single

Musical theatre group Collabro are releasing a charity single after one of its members was caught up in Hurricane Irma.

The track, titled Lighthouse, will see all proceeds go to the Save The Children Emergency Fund, which helps children affected by war and disasters around the world.

The decision to produce the single was made by the band after one of its members, Michael Auger, witnessed hurricane Irma's destruction first-hand while on holiday on the Caribbean island of Saint Martin.

"The devastation left in the wake of Hurricane Irma is truly heart-breaking for the people of the Caribbean and Florida," he said.

"I know I was very lucky to escape unharmed but there are many thousands of people who have lost everything and will feel the effects of this disaster for years to come."

Collabro issued a statement saying they "wanted to do something to help those affected" after seeing "what Michael went through".

The band, who won Britain's Got Talent in 2014, said: "Save The Children does amazing work around the world and are a beacon of hope for young people and families caught up in war and natural disasters."

Save The Children have said they are "grateful to Collabro and their fans" for "raising vital money for emergencies around the world".

"Every download of Lighthouse means that we can continue to mobilise teams and reach the most vulnerable families at times of crisis."

Lighthouse is available to digitally download on 22 September.
